The Role:

We seek a highly skilled, talented, and motivated Sr. Principal Research Associate to join our collaborative group. This team member will participate in developing and performing routine and specialized tissue-based assays to characterize mRNA delivery and protein expression to support the advancement of Moderna’s mRNA technology platform and pipeline.  This position requires strong reasoning, detail orientation and problem-solving abilities.

Here’s What You’ll Do:

  • Work in a timely and efficient manner to generate high quality data to support research and early development programs.

  • Performs IHC, IF, and ISH staining on tissue sections and subsequent image acquisition and analysis.

  • General laboratory work including lab equipment maintenance, QC of inventory, and sample management.

  • Record experimental results and communicate findings.

  • Exhibit excellent oral and written communication skills.

  • Collaborate with project team members and peers to anticipate and resolve day-to-day issues working in a matrix organizational structure.

Here’s What You’ll Bring to the Table:

  • BS/MS (Cell Biology, Biochemistry, Molecular Biology, or related science) with at least 3-5 years relevant industry experience performing histopathology assays.

  • Experience with performing IHC/ISH staining assays and knowledge of automated systems (i.e. Leica and Ventana autostainers).

  • Histopathology laboratory experience preferred with general knowledge related to staining tissue specimen, and whole slide scanners.

  • Ability to multi-task to meet timelines, and technology development and research goals.

  • Excellent interpersonal and collaborative skills, and the ability to work independently and effectively in a highly dynamic environment.

  • Collaborative, enthusiastic, and eager to participate in multiple collaborative projects in a cross-functional team environment

About Moderna

In over 10 years since its inception, Moderna has transformed from a research-stage company advancing programs in the field of messenger RNA (mRNA), to an enterprise with a diverse clinical portfolio of vaccines and therapeutics across seven modalities, a broad intellectual property portfolio in areas including mRNA and lipid nanoparticle formulation, and an integrated manufacturing plant that allows for rapid clinical and commercial production at scale. Moderna maintains alliances with a broad range of domestic and overseas government and commercial collaborators, which has allowed for the pursuit of both groundbreaking science and rapid scaling of manufacturing. Most recently, Moderna's capabilities have come together to allow the authorized use and approval of one of the earliest and most effective vaccines against the COVID-19 pandemic.

Moderna's mRNA platform builds on continuous advances in basic and applied mRNA science, delivery technology and manufacturing, and has allowed the development of therapeutics and vaccines for infectious diseases, immuno-oncology, rare diseases, cardiovascular diseases and autoimmune diseases.
